SESN and NEON online events
Based on feedback from network members, as of January 2026 we are trialling a new process for attendance at our regular online meetings of SESN and NEON. Members were previously required to register for each individual meeting; Instead, calendar appointments will now be sent to all those signed up to our Jiscmail list for each network and members will be asked to accept/decline to confirm whether they plan to attend each online meeting (in-person network meetings will still require registration for practical purposes). See the SESN and NEON pages for links to join the Jiscmail if you wish to join either network and please contact us at admin@sparqs.ac.uk if you have any queries.
